Over the past decade, the landscape of online gaming and gambling has undergone a metamorphosis driven by technological innovation and a growing emphasis on transparency and player sovereignty. Traditional platforms, once reliant solely on their internal algorithms, have increasingly sought methods to demonstrate fairness and build trust with their user base.
Early online gambling sites depended heavily on company-controlled random number generators (RNGs), which, while statistically fair, lacked transparency—leading to widespread skepticism among players. Recent advancements have introduced cryptographic techniques that allow users to independently verify game fairness in real-time, fostering a new era of integrity.
Insight: Pioneering platforms now utilize cryptographic hashes and provably fair algorithms to assure users that game outcomes are untampered, aligning industry standards with accountability and trustworthiness.
A key innovation enabling this shift is the integration of cryptographic proof systems that empower players to independently validate game results. Platforms adopting these systems provide transparent methods, such as seed generation and hash commitments, to ensure outcomes are not manipulated post-game.
This approach not only enhances trust but also transforms players from passive consumers into active participants in verifying fairness, an essential evolution in a digitally interconnected gambling ecosystem.
